Crispy Cheese Borek

The Crispy Cheese Borek is an authentic Turkish appetizer with stuffing phyllo dough and a mix of cheese. Since it's a quick and easy-to-make appetizer, it will go perfectly with any occasion, and it's a great match for Ramadan.

Prep Time 35 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 1 hour
Course Appetizer, Dinner, Dough, Side Dish
Cuisine Middle Eastern, turkish
Servings 20 pieces

Ingredients
  

  • 16 sheets phyllo dough
  • 8 ounces cream cheese
  • 14 ounces can Feta cheese or whatever white cheese you prefer
  • parsley optional
  • ¾ cup butter melted
  • 1 egg for brushing

Instructions
 

  • Mix the cheeses and parsley (if using) together. This works best if the cream cheese is at room temperature unless you're using the spreadable kind.
  • Spread 1 sheet of phyllo dough, and brush with melted butter.
  • Then top with another sheet and brush again, until you finish 3 sheets.
  • Add the cheese mixture close to the long edge of the sheet, then roll it up into a log.
  • Cut each large log in half and add it to your sprayed quarter sheet pan (9x13). Repeat with the rest.
  • Once arranged, cut each log in half. Brush with a beaten egg, and sprinkle black sesame seeds and regular sesame seeds if you'd like.
  • Bake at 400 degrees F for 20-25 mins or until its golden.

Notes

  • Phyllo dough is so delicate that it may tear while working with it. But don't worry, a few tears won't ruin the dish if you pinch the phyllo dough back together.
  • Make sure to cover the phyllo dough sheets with a damp towel to prevent them from drying.
  • In order to make serving and cutting much easier, slice the borek pastry before placing it in the oven. When you're finished layering your borek, simply slice the dough into your desired portion sizes.
  • Leave the borek in the fridge for a night before baking because this will allow the phyllo dough to absorb the flavorful liquid, adding moisture and savoriness to your pastry.
  • Strain your veggies to avoid having soggy pastry.
